> We have an electronic mail ballot. Votes are due to the LNC-Business
> list by July 22, 2018 at 11:59:59pm Pacific time. Co-Sponsors:
> Bishop-Henchman, Harlos, Merced, Nekhaila, Van Horn Motion: Create
> an
> ad hoc Retention & Outreach Committee to research and prepare a
> document and training detailing causes and trends of member losses
> and
> gains then making recommendations to the LNC on actions it can take
> to
> improve membership retention and growth. The document should also
> include suggestions that candidates and affiliates can take to
> identify
> and retain “at-risk” donors and volunteers and an appendix of
> members
> who are subject experts that are open to being resources for
> targeted
> outreach. The Committee will prepare an outline of the document by
> February 15th, 2019 and submit a rough draft for approval no later
> than
> the fifth LNC meeting of the term. The Committee will develop, with
> support of LNC Staff, training for candidates, their staff and
> affiliates both online and to be presented in LP training workshops.
> The committee will be composed of 11 members with 3 LNC
> members/alternates and 8 non-LNC members of the LP. The 3 LNC
> members
> are appointed by the LNC with an Interim Chair appointed by the LNC
> Chair, the 8 Non-LNC Members are appointed by the 8 regional reps
> each
> choosing one member from their region to serve. The Committee will
> submit a final document at the LNC meeting immediately preceding the
> LP
> National Convention in 2020.
